BLACKBURN MUSEUM & ART GALLERY

Museum Street, Blackburn BB1 7AJ, UK Directions

Since 1874

Speciality:

Gallery Museum Coins and Manuscripts Collections Decorative Arts Egyptology Fine Arts Natural History Social History and South Asian Collections Learning Sessions Loan Boxes Special Events School Programs Gift Shop Full Disabled Access

Blackburn Museum & Art Gallery serves as both an art gallery and a museum with diverse collections featuring Christian icons, Egyptian hieroglyphs, and local history. The gallery's intriguing exhibits cover fine art, decorative art, Egyptology, coins, manuscripts, natural history, social history, and South Asian art. Notably, they house remarkable Japanese prints amassed by Thomas Boys Lewis. Blackburn Museum & Art Gallery hosts children's activities, workshops, and special events. Admission is complimentary for all guests. The Decorative Arts collection includes icons, ceramics, textiles, and furniture.

2025 Update: The museum holds the largest collection of religious icons outside of London.

PRISM CONTEMPORARY

20 Lord street West, Blackburn BB2 1JX, UK Directions

Since 2016

Speciality:

Art Collections Exhibitions Events Art Displays Graphic Workshop Sculpture Workshop and Painting Studio

PRISM Contemporary is an independent gallery that was founded by artists, curators, and producers, with Lydia McCaig as the gallery manager. The gallery offers a space for both national and international creatives and functions as a research hub with a studio complex. They support existing artistic communities, cultural events, and festivals while fostering new creative partnerships, commissions, exhibitions, and collaborations. Their creative artwork encourages visitors to return to the gallery repeatedly. PRISM Contemporary's goal is to challenge, inspire, and engage audiences locally, nationally, and internationally.

2025 Update: PRISM Contemporary is a gallery and artist studio space that supports creative communities and cultural events.

THE BUREAU CENTRE FOR THE ARTS

5 Exchange Street, Blackburn BB1 7JN, UK Directions

Since 2014

Speciality:

Art Work Paintings Exhibitions Events Picture Frame and Art Gallery

The Bureau Centre for the Arts aims to establish a welcoming and safe space where people can gather, create, and experience visual art. The art gallery secured a lease from the council to continue using the venue and organised a variety of arts activities, events, and performances at St John’s for a growing number of participants and audiences. Each director contributed unique skills, experience, and knowledge of different art forms to the organisation, along with a passion for making the venue a lively and engaging place. The Bureau Centre for the Arts is committed to offering opportunities for emerging artists to develop and showcase their work while also bringing in professional artists to perform and teach.

2025 Update: Their mission is to create an accessible space for arts and culture, supporting a diverse and vibrant creative community.
